Transaction 2267c07462dbedb3f160c7963417af463be50c9e996003475a180c0972b39ea7
1 Input
1 Output
-
2267c07462dbedb3f160c7963417af463be50c9e996003475a180c0972b39ea7:0
- value
- 24894
- script pubkey
- OP_0 OP_PUSHBYTES_20 aaa38d6d871aaeb8dbe589754c28d35a88246777
- address
- bc1q423c6mv8r2ht3kl93965c2xnt2yzgemhyq9ea5